KPIG, of Freedom CA (near Gilroy in Monterey County, south of San Francisco) is the offspring of KFAT which in turn was the offspring of KMPX (San Francisco) which in turn was the offspring of KSAN ("the listener's fren" in the flowering of the Haight Ashbury).

KSAN and KMPX were LITERALLY the ancestors of "album rock."

sziami is a kind of underground-alternative rock or stg like that band, producing good stuff since the eighties. The texts are very funny but almost all in hungarian. The newest album called 'valoperes rock' makes fun a bit of the 'lakodalmas rock' which is a 'style' cultivated at village weddings by 'rockstars' singing about their adventures with young ladies, mostly, or about how drunk they got at a place and how good friends they are and such, accompanied by very bad music. The expression 'lakodalmas rock' could be translated as 'wedding rock music', while the stuff i'm listening to is 'valoperes rock' that is stg like 'divorce trial rock music', the text goes on and on about the failures of a guy with women, etc.
